Antique Map of the Lorraine Region 'France' (c.1735)

About the Item

Antique map titled 'Carte du Duche de Lorraine - Kaart van Lotharingen'. A detailed map of the Duchy of Lorraine. The map is surrounded by thirteen vignette bird-eye view of fortified towns and cities with Nancy occupying the central position along the lower border. Source unknown, to be determined.
